Output d1f3a8950e59bf6a008638c9c30810025aa3afb6655828804377fd645254a617:10

value
43671824
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45190079f49fd9f0ae4b9d112f21cd2ef55e7da9 OP_EQUAL
address
MECWopsiHVtWfGWN9b1TDqi5XSzqU2u4sy
transaction
d1f3a8950e59bf6a008638c9c30810025aa3afb6655828804377fd645254a617
spent
true